A moving and storage company is looking for part-time workers in Langley, England. The role requires loading and unloading products and materials, operating equipment, and providing customer service.
Candidates must be proactive and able to handle heavy loads, as well as work in physically demanding conditions. Steel-toed safety boots are required.
Flexible hours are available, ranging from 10 to 28 hours weekly.
